Position Overview:

As a Soils Lab Technician, you will collect, label, and prepare soil samples for testing, perform various soil tests, record and analyze data, and ensure compliance with safety and quality standards. You will also maintain lab equipment, document procedures, collaborate with team members, and provide technical support and training.

Roles and Responsibilities:
  • Collect and label soil samples from various locations and depths.
  • Prepare samples for testing (drying, sieving, etc.).
  • Perform soil tests: grain size analysis, Atterberg limits, compaction tests, soil moisture content, specific gravity, permeability, and unconfined compressive strength.
  • Follow standard testing procedures (e.g., ASTM, AASHTO).
  • Record and log test results accurately.
  • Use software tools to analyze data and generate reports.
  • Interpret test results and provide insights.
  • Operate and maintain lab equipment.
  • Troubleshoot and perform minor repairs on equipment.
  • Adhere to quality control and assurance procedures.
  • Participate in proficiency testing programs.
  • Ensure compliance with safety regulations and best practices.
  • Prepare detailed test reports.
  • Document procedures, observations, and results.
  • Maintain organized records and files.
  • Collaborate with engineers, scientists, and technical staff.
  • Communicate test progress, issues, and results.
  • Provide technical support and training to junior staff or interns.
  • Follow health and safety guidelines.
  • Participate in safety training and drills.
Minimum Qualifications/Required Skills and Abilities:
  • 5–10 years of experience in a laboratory setting, particularly with soil testing.
  • Certification from relevant professional organizations (e.g., NICET, ACI) in soil testing or laboratory practices.
  • Basic understanding of soil properties and testing methods.
  • Proficiency in using laboratory equipment and instruments.
  • Strong attention to detail and accuracy.
  • Good record-keeping and data entry skills.
  • Ability to follow standard procedures and protocols.
  • Basic computer skills, including familiarity with data analysis software.
